This competition was created to encourage newer or less experienced players to be in with a chance to win a competition which is normally dominated by the upper echelon players. Think of it as a Pro-Am competition like in golf.

Once all entries have been counted, for example, 36 people have entered, I will go through and select each player based on their skill level and where they play in the league and categorize them into Group A or Group B. 

I will then run a randomised draw of 1 player from each group to create the "Lucky Dip Pairs"

This will be like any other knockout competition and the format remains the same starting with group stages then go through to a knockout. 

Best two teams out of each group will go through then the remaining spots for top 16 will go to the next best points teams. If there is a tie, then it will go to frames won. If there is still a tie, it will go to a 6 red shootout. 

 

Race to 3 - Group stages

Race to 4 - Semi's

Race to 5 - Finals

All frames are to be played to International rules

As per the recent AGM proposal, you will be allowed to discuss after the break when you pot off the break

Shot clock will be introduced in the finals - 45 seconds with one 15-second extension per frame
